How is your life currently different from how it was four months ago?
The difference in my life in the last month is that I have never lacked what to eat in my house. Before the transfers, I used to go without food on many occasions because of my low income from casual work. I do not have anyone to help me out so I would struggle by myself to get food. As a result, I missed so many meals but GD transfers have changed my life because have always had food to eat. Thanks to GD for the transfers.
Do you have any new or additional goals for your life for the next four months?
My new goal in the next four months is to plaster the house. Incase God grants me a long life, I would not want to budget again for another house. This is why I want to plaster my house to make it strong and durable.
Describe the biggest difference in your daily life in the last four months preceding the current transfer.
The fact that I have an iron-roofed house is a miracle in my life. As a widow who only depend on a small income from farming, I did not now I would ever manage to build a new house after the death of my husband. I had decided I will die in the house my husband left me in. When I started receiving these transfers, I used them on buying building material which I use on putting up a new house. Thanks to GD
How do you expect your life to change in the next six months?
I expect my life to change in the six months in that I will have plastered my house. I want to save part of my monthly transfers so that I may be able to buy building materials for plastering the house. I know I will achieve it because GD will never fail to send the money

How is your life currently different from how it was four months ago?
My life is now different from how it was four months ago because I eat clean food. I no longer prepare my meals in open-air. This after I managed to construct a kitchen. I no longer congest my already congested main house in the name of preparing food.
Do you have any new or additional goals for your life for the next four months?
My new goal is to expand my current house that is too small to comfortably accommodate my large family. When I have a bigger house, I will have room to buy other household assets like furniture.
Describe the biggest difference in your daily life in the last four months preceding the current transfer.
The biggest difference in my daily life is that I managed to construct a kitchen where I can cook from. I have ceased from cooking outside under trees with was so unhealthy because of the dust, the winds, besides being inconveniencing as you cannot prepare food any time you want. You have to consider the weather condition at that time. I am happy I am now feeding on healthy foods and I can now prepare the food at any time I wish.
How do you expect your life to change in the next six months?
In the next six months, I am hoping that I shall have started saving some money for the purpose of expanding my current house that is so small and uncomfortable for my big family.

How is your life currently different from how it was four months ago?
Currently, my life is different than it was four months ago because my involvement in casual jobs is not as intense as it was before. From the transfers, I have been able to easily buy food for my household thus we have never gone to sleep hungry. In the past, we could occasionally sleep hungry due to lack of food.
Do you have any new or additional goals for your life for the next four months?
In the next four months, my additional goal is to build a new and decent house. I shall save some of my transfers to buy iron sheets and other building materials which will be used for the construction of my house. The house I am currently living in is small and yet I do not have even an external kitchen.
Describe the biggest difference in your daily life in the last four months preceding the current transfer.
The biggest difference in my in the last four months preceding the current transfer is the assurance of monthly income. I have been able to plan well on how to spend it on buying food for my household. It has also made my life better since I do not need to fully depend on hard labor. Although I continue to do casual jobs to supplement my household's income, the rate at which I go for casual jobs has greatly gone down.
How do you expect your life to change in the next six months?
In the next six months, I expect my new house to be fully built. This will bring a big change in my life since in it there will be a kitchen and another room for my visitors. I shall, therefore, be able to stay till late at night as I catch up with my visitors. I have always been afraid to stay till late with the visitors because I always have to take them to the neighborhood where they often sleep.

How is your life currently different from how it was four months ago?
My life is different because right now I have a shelter for myself that is more descent than what I used to have before. I initially used to sleep in a grass thatched house that could easily collapse on me especially during rainy seasons, but right now I do not have to fear for such calamities anymore.
Do you have any new or additional goals for your life for the next four months?
Right now I am planning to buy a few livestock that I will be able to rear within my compound and God willing I should be able to make some profits by selling them out in the future. I want to sort out by buying a sheep that will definitely give birth and the more it gives birth, the more livestock I will have which then translates to more income in the future.
Describe the biggest difference in your daily life in the last four months preceding the current transfer.
I have been able to build a house for myself using the little cash that I have been receiving from the organization over the past eight months. I started by making some little savings every month and finally I topped up with some cash that I had from my small scale business. Owning a house has always been an elusive dream for me for quite a long time and the main reason why I have never been to build a house is due to lack of a stable income that could enable me complete such a project.
How do you expect your life to change in the next six months?
I think in the near future I will start using better fertilizers from one acre fund that I have always not been able to use due to their high prices. The high quality fertilizers will enable me get more farm harvest at the end of the planting season which will then translate to more food for the family.

What is the biggest hardship you've faced in your life?
The biggest hardship have faced in life was,when i lost my husband and three children through death.
What is the happiest part of your day?
The happiest part of my day is in the afternoon when I am done with farming, and am back home to meet, play and laugh with my grand children.
What are you planning to spend your transfer on?
I am planning to spend my transfer to improve my house since the current one is leaking.
What is the achievement you are proudest of?
The achievement that I am proudest of was my small business of selling fish,I was able to pay school fees for my children with no difficulties.
